Government Sector Projects at Kuwait International Airport Administration Building, Car Park and Fire Stations Package No.

2 DOCUMENT III-2: PARTICULAR SPECIFICATIONS SECTION 01100 - SUMMARY PART 1 GENERAL 1.1 RELATED DOCUMENTS A. Drawings and general provisions of the Contract, including Conditions of Contract and other Division 1 Specification Sections, apply to this Section. 1.2 WORK COVERED BY CONTRACT DOCUMENTS A. Project Identification: Project comprises the design construction, completion and remedying defects during the Defects Liability Period of the works under Kuwait International Airport, Package 2- Administration Building & Fire Stations. B. The Employer: Directorate General of Civil Aviation - Government Sector Projects at Kuwait International Airport. C. The Engineer: Dar Al-Handasah Consultants (Shair & Partners) in association with Jassim Qabazard Engineering Consultants. D. The Works in this Contract briefly includes but is not limited to the design and execution of the following: 1. Design development and construction of the Fire Stations. 2. Design development and construction of Administration Building with its Car Park. 3. Installation of all necessary electromechanical Works, Utilities, landscaping, irrigation and roads. 1.3 CONTRACTS A. The Government Sector Projects at Kuwait International Airport will be constructed under multiple contracts (Packages) as detailed in the Employer's Requirements (Document III-1). B. These separate Sections/Packages and contracts, represent significant construction activities, that are correlated with the Works under this Package 2. The different parts of the works under this Contract may be performed sequentially or concurrently or partially sequentially and partly concurrently and require to be coordinated closely with construction activities performed under other sections/packages and contracts. Sections/Packages and contracts for this Project include, but are not limited to, the following: 1. Package 1: Runways 15C/33C, Taxiways, Aprons & Access Roads. 2. Package 3: Runways 15L/33R and 15R/33L, Taxiways and Aprons

Government Sector Projects at Kuwait International Airport Administration Building, Car Park and Fire Stations Package No.2 DOCUMENT III-2: PARTICULAR SPECIFICATIONS C. Coordination is identified in Division 1 Section "Summary of Multiple Contracts". 1.4 WORK SEQUENCE A. The Work shall be executed in parallel and completed in the stages defined in the Employer's Requirements and within the periods set in the Appendix to Tender. 1.5 WORK UNDER OTHER CONTRACTS A. Separate Contract: The Employer has awarded and will award separate contracts for performance of certain construction operations at, or in the proximity of, the Site. These operations are scheduled to be either substantially complete before work under this Contract begins, or conducted concurrently with work under this Contract. The separate contracts include, but not by way of limitation, the following: 1. Package 1: Runways 15C/33C, Taxiways, Aprons & Access Roads. 2. Package 3: Runways 15L/33R and 15R/33L, Taxiways and Aprons 3. Projects under Construction a. Kuwait Airspace System Plan (KASP) b. Kuwait Aviation Fuelling Company (KAFCO) c. Fuel Support Facility d. Main Jet Fuel Line e. Existing Cargo Apron Extension f. Taxiways surrounding Fuel Support Facility g. VVIP Area h. Electrical Substations i. New Airport Fence and Gates 4. Planned Projects a. Pax. Terminal 2 Building b. Catering Facility c. Air Force Compound d. South and North Power Stations e. Interchanges at the access points to the airport f. Aircraft Maintenance B. Cooperate fully and coordinate with separate contractors and Programme the Works so that work on those contracts may be carried out efficiently and effectively. The Contractor shall also replan his activities to minimize interference with other contractors.

Government Sector Projects at Kuwait International Airport Administration Building, Car Park and Fire Stations Package No.2 DOCUMENT III-2: PARTICULAR SPECIFICATIONS 1.6 FUTURE WORK A. Future Contracts: The Employer reserves the right to perform additional work and/or award further separate contracts for performance of additional work at the Project Site; whether concurrently with, or after substantial completion of, Work under this Contract. Performance and completion of such additional work may depend on successful completion of preparatory work under this Contract. B. Cooperate fully and coordinate with any future construction forces and/or separate contractors as necessary, and Programme the Works so far as reasonably possible so that work on those contracts may be carried out efficiently and effectively, without interfering with or delaying work under this Contract. In Particular, Aprons Contractor shall schedule and organize some of the pavement works around the buildings to have them executed only after the Buildings Contractor completes the surrounds of the buildings.
